Big Bookstore, Indie Shops, or eBooks?
Got some data in today.These numbers may be of interest to my fellow local authors.
Chapters/Indigo/Coles 34.9%Comic Book Shops 21.44%Indie Bookshops 11.9%Events 20.67%Private Sales 7.35%ebooks 3.75%This is the distribution of sales through various venues.
Although it appears that Chapters/Indigo/Coles moves the highest volumes, if we count Comic Book Shops as "Independent Bookshops" (21.44% + 11.9% = 33.34%) the indie book stores equals the giant Chapters/Indigo/Coles. (And these numbers do not consider the larger percentage of commission into the equation.
Chapters/Indigo/Coles take 45% off the retail price - ouch! - whereas many small, private and local lndie book stores usually take anywhere between 25% - 40%. That translates into either more profit for the author or the ability to offer better deals to move more books!)Although I realize these number will not be the same for every author, they're still interesting information.The indie bookstores, I believe, draw a more eclectic and openminded audience (maybe even a better read crowd!)I have always been of the idea that ebooks are brutally difficult to 'sell'. (Let's not forget, sure there are no overhead costs, but you are a single voice screaming into a sea of literally tens of millions! It can be near impossible to be heard).
